The surface area S (in square meters) of a hot-air balloon is given by S(r)=4πr2, where r is the radius of the balloon (in meters).If the radius r is increasing with time t (in seconds) according to the formula r(t)=23t3, t0, find the surface area S of the balloon as a function of the time t.

1Step 1. Given Information

Given that S(r)=4πr2 and r(t)=23t3, t0.

2Step 2. Solution

We have to find surface area S of the balloon as a function of time t.

We have S(r) is function of r and r(t) is function of t.

So, we have to find Sr(t).

Now,

Sr(t)=S(r(t))Sr(t)=4π{r(t)}2 Sr(t)=4π23t32Sr(t)=4π49t6Sr(t)=169πt6.

3Step3. Final Answer

Hence, S as a function of t is S(t)=169πt6.
